IN THE HIGH COURT AT CALCUTTA

Constitutional Writ Jurisdiction Appellate Side C.O. 3152 of 2022 Somnath Roy VS Smt. Jayabati Ghosh & Ors.

Mr. Jayanta Samanta Ms. Karunamayee Samanta ...... for the petitioner Affidavit of service filed by the petitioner in Court No. 8 01.11.2023 (Item No. 3) (AB) Court today are kept on record.

The instant civil revision has been preferred by the petitioner against the impugned order No. 5 dated 17.9.2022 passed by the learned Court below in Ejectment Appeal No. 5 of 2022 wherein the appellate Court has directed the petitioner to deposit the occupational charges to the tune of Rs.5,000/- per month. It is the submission of the learned advocate for the petitioner that the amount of occupational charges is exorbitant so he moves the instant civil revisional application before this Court. After hearing the learned advocate for the petitioner an interim order was passed by this court on 12th October, 2022 directing the present petitioner to deposit the occupational charges of Rs.2500/- per month instead of Rs.5000/-. The petitioner was also directed to serve upon the opposite parties in respect of the order dated 12th October, 2022.

It appears from the affidavit of service that the petitioner has served upon the opposite parties and it further appears from the challans that the petitioner is regularly depositing the occupational charges of Rs.2,500/- with the learned Court below. The entire revisional application is pending since one year but on no occasion the opposite parties appeared.

The learned advocate for the petitioner submits that the opposite parties are not at all interested to contest this matter, or they have no objection against the interim order passed by this Court. Accordingly, the instant civil revisional application may be disposed of by confirming the interim order.

Heard the learned advocate for the petitioner. Perused the interim order passed by this Court on 12th October, 2022.

Considering the entire circumstances the instant civil revision is disposed of with the direction that the occupational charges as ordered by the learned appellate Court to the tune of Rs.5,000/- per month is hereby modified and reduced to Rs.2,500/- per month.

Other portions of the impugned order shall remain unaltered.

Accordingly civil revision being C.O. 3152 of 2022 stands disposed of.

There shall, however, be no order as to costs.
